What is SellerSprite
SellerSprite is an analytics and optimization toolset focused on Amazon marketplace sellers and brands. It supports product and keyword research, listing optimization, and competitive monitoring to inform merchandising and advertising decisions. The product is typically used by Amazon-focused operators, agencies, and brand teams that need data to plan launches and improve search visibility. It differentiates by concentrating on Amazon-specific research workflows rather than broader multi-channel commerce operations.
Amazon keyword research workflows
SellerSprite centers on keyword discovery and analysis for Amazon search, which aligns with day-to-day listing and PPC planning tasks. It helps users identify candidate terms, evaluate relative demand, and prioritize optimization work. This focus can reduce reliance on manual spreadsheet-based research. It is most useful when Amazon search performance is the primary growth lever.
Product and competitor tracking
The platform supports monitoring of products and competitors to inform pricing, positioning, and assortment decisions. Users can track changes over time and use the data to validate launch or optimization hypotheses. This is a common requirement in marketplace optimization stacks where teams need repeatable reporting. It complements operational tools that handle order or catalog execution.
Listing optimization support
SellerSprite provides features intended to guide listing improvements based on keyword and category insights. This can help standardize how teams update titles, bullets, and other on-page elements. It is suited to agencies or internal teams managing many ASINs and needing consistent processes. The emphasis is on optimization guidance rather than end-to-end commerce management.
Limited multi-channel breadth
SellerSprite is primarily oriented around Amazon, so it may not cover the same breadth of channels as broader e-commerce platforms. Organizations selling across multiple marketplaces and webstores may still need separate tools for feed management, order management, and cross-channel analytics. This can increase tool fragmentation. Fit depends on whether Amazon is the dominant revenue channel.
Not an execution platform
The product focuses on research and optimization insights rather than operational execution such as inventory, fulfillment, customer support, or marketplace integrations for order flow. Teams often pair it with other systems to implement changes at scale. If a buyer expects an all-in-one commerce suite, SellerSprite may not meet that requirement. It is better positioned as an optimization layer.
Data transparency varies by metric
As with many marketplace intelligence tools, some metrics rely on estimates or modeled data rather than first-party reporting. This can create uncertainty when users need auditability for forecasting or financial planning. Buyers may need to validate critical decisions with additional sources (e.g., internal sales data or marketplace reports). The impact depends on how the organization uses the outputs.
Plan & Pricing
| Plan | Price | Key features & notes |
|---|---|---|
| Free | Free / month | Global marketplace access; limited records (first 5) for Keyword Mining, Keyword Research, Reverse ASIN; limited extension queries; Keyword Checker unlimited; 1 main account + 0 child; no product/keyword tracking. |
| Standard (monthly) | $79 / month (List price $98/month) | Unlimited access to core research tools (Keyword Mining, Keyword Research, Reverse ASIN, Competitor/Product/Market Research), Browser Extension, Complete Keepa history; Product Tracking 100; Keyword Tracking 500; Storefront Tracker 50; Data export 50 queries/day; 1 main account + 0 child. |
| Basic (annual) | $390 / year (List price $468/year) | Annual-only tier in pricing page: Product Tracking 50; Keyword Tracking 250; Storefront Tracker 25; includes full toolset and extension; 1 main account + 0 child. |
| Standard (annual) | $790 / year (List price $948/year) | Most popular annual tier: Product Tracking 100; Keyword Tracking 500; Storefront Tracker 50; 1 main + 3 child accounts (tracking limit sharing). |
| Advanced (annual) | $1,290 / year (List price $1,548/year) | Higher limits: Product Tracking 300; Keyword Tracking 1000; Storefront Tracker 100; 1 main + 6 child accounts. |
| VIP (annual) | $1,890 / year (List price $2,268/year) | Highest limits: Product Tracking 500; Keyword Tracking 2000; Storefront Tracker 200; 1 main + 10 child accounts. |
API / usage-based (vendor site lists separate API packages): Pricing model: Pay-as-you-go (monthly API packages) Free tier/trial: Some weekly trial options for API competitor lookup are listed. Example costs (from official API section):
- Individual / Competitor Research: 20,000 requests/month – $499 / month (also shows a 6,000 requests/week $99 trial).
- Individual / Product Research: 20,000 requests/month – $599 / month.
- Individual / Keyword Mining: 40,000 requests/month – $899 / month.
- Individual / Google Trends: 40,000 requests/month – $199 / month.
- Individual / ASIN Details: 50,000 requests/month – $149 / month.
- Business / Competitor Research: 50,000 requests/month – $999 / month.
- Business / Product Research: 50,000 requests/month – $1,499 / month.
- Business / Keyword Mining: 50,000 requests/month – $1,899 / month. Discounts / notes: Annual billing claims savings (page notes up to ~16% or "30%" in FAQ depending on display); the site shows list prices and discounted prices for annual plans. API packages mention half-year and annual options and require contacting sales for custom endpoints/volume.
